As the whole country gears up to celebrate the 250th birthday of the United States of America, ONE will showcase two new works by American composers and end our concert with one of America’s most cherished masterpieces, Aaron Copland’s "Appalachian Spring."

Composer Jan Swafford (also know for his masterful biographies Mozart, Beethoven, Brahms, and Ives) has written for ONE a work for strings, The River. Composer Neely Bruce of Wesleyan University has offered to us for premiere his Concerto for Violin.

The violin soloist will be ONE’s own Gary Capozziello who teaches at the Hartt School of Music, Promisek Bach+ workshops, and the Hotchkiss School, and is additionally the assistant concertmaster of the Hartford Symphony Orchestra.
